    Chapter 15 Confession

    "Xiao Xiao, Brother Sheng, what's going on?"

    Ye Changyuan arrived late, pushing his way through the crowd.

    Ye Xiaoxiao reassured him, "Brother Yuan, you take care of the tables and chairs. Fourth Brother and I are heading to the police station. We're okay, just going to help with the testimony."

    Ye Changyuan: "Then I'll pack up and come find you."

    Making money is the last thing on our minds now; safety comes first.

    Ye Xiaoxiao nodded.

    Lu Hanchuan asked, "Should we take a car?"

    Ye Xiaoxiao was silent.

    Han Xing was shocked!

    Ye Xiaoxiao was still trying to figure out who these two were. How could they take a car? The space is too cramped; they'd be found out in no time.

    "It's pretty close, just a short walk."

    She tried to be vague.

    That pretty boy just called him 'Brother Lu,' and with the surname Lu in the compound...

    Lu Hanchuan nodded, "Then let's walk together then."

    He nudged Han Xing, "Go tell Xiao Li."

    Han Xing: "Uh... okay."

    He left, puzzled.

    Ye Changsheng walked next to Ye Xiaoxiao, who walked beside Lu Hanchuan.

    The three of them walked in silence.

    Ye Changsheng was curious about who this person was; it seemed he knew Xiao Xiao.

    Then... could this person take Xiao Xiao with him?

    Ye Xiaoxiao was racking her brain trying to remember the plot of that novel.

    Why hadn't she memorized the whole book back then?

    Now she regretted it.

    At the police station, the matter was quickly cleared up.

    Zhang Laowu, Zhang Guimei's brother, had come today specifically to cause trouble for Ye Xiaoxiao and the others.

    This behavior was particularly egregious, especially with the national crackdown on black and evil forces, and Lu Hanchuan's involvement.

    Zhang Laowu and these accomplices are definitely going to jail.

    They also had to compensate the beaten brother for his medical expenses and cover all future treatment costs.

    Zhang Guimei is also responsible and will have to spend a few days in custody even if she doesn’t go to jail.

    Ye Xiaoxiao was fairly satisfied with the outcome of the case.

    After leaving the police station, she said to Lu Hanchuan, "Thanks for helping us out."

    Han Xing was waiting at the front door.

    As soon as he saw them come out, he immediately approached, first looking at Ye Xiaoxiao.

    "You’re Hao Xiaoxiao, right? From our neighborhood compound. I’ve heard Jianwen talk about you. What are you doing here?"

    Han Xing’s words revealed important information to Ye Xiaoxiao.

    They knew each other, but not well!

    So she could easily act like she didn’t know him.

    Just then, Ye Changyuan also ran over, "Xiao Xiao, are you finished?"

    Ye Xiaoxiao: "Fourth Brother, Brother Yuan, I have something to discuss with these two guys."

    Ye Changsheng: "We’ll be over there waiting for you."

    Ye Xiaoxiao nodded.

    Ye Changyuan, curious, pulled Ye Changsheng aside to ask what had happened.

    Ye Xiaoxiao looked at the two men in front of her: "Do you know Xu Jianwen?"

    She was familiar with Xu Jianwen.

    The main male character in the story.

    Since this was a female-centric novel, the male lead’s character inevitably had some flaws, like being aloof and overly concerned with appearances, but he would definitely change because of the female lead, and they would end up happily together.

    "Not exactly friends..." Han Xing rubbed his chin thoughtfully.

    Although they were all children from the compound, they were two years older than Xu Jianwen’s group, with different experiences and perspectives, so they naturally didn’t hang out together.

    They’d bump into each other now and then and chat.

    Hearing this answer, Ye Xiaoxiao was relieved.

    "My name’s Ye Xiaoxiao now. Seventeen years ago, my mother and Mrs. Hao were stationed at the military base together. During childbirth, they got caught in a local rainstorm disaster and ended up swapping babies.

    A month ago, the Hao family’s real child returned to their home in the capital, so naturally, I should return to my own home."

    Ye Xiaoxiao summed it up quickly.

    Han Xing was dumbfounded. He couldn’t believe what he was hearing.

    Even movies don’t have such a complicated plot.

    Han Xing was still confused, "So... you’re not going back to the capital? What about Xu Jianwen? You’re his fiancée, doesn’t he care?"

    Ye Xiaoxiao was delighted inside. She’d been waiting for this moment.

    She’d been hoping he’d ask.

    What a perfect chance to distance myself!

    "That's the fiancé chosen by the Hao family. Since Hao Yanyan has returned home, the fiancé naturally belongs to her and has nothing to do with me."

    Ye Xiaoxiao's voice was soft, clear, and pleasant.

    As she spoke, there was a hint of mischief in her eyes, like a clever little fox.

    Lu Hanchuan noticed her subtle gestures, sensing there was more to this than met the eye.

    At least half of what she just said was probably a lie.

    And although Ye Xiaoxiao looked regretful, he couldn't shake the feeling that the young girl was... low-key thrilled.

    "Then you... you..."

    Han Xing continued to fidget awkwardly, unsure of what to say.

    Should he comfort her? She didn’t seem all that upset.

    Give advice? They weren’t exactly close.

    "Anyway, I want to thank you both for your concern. I don't even know your names yet."

    Ye Xiaoxiao smiled sweetly, her eyes curving into crescents.

    Han Xing awkwardly avoided the young girl's piercing eyes, "I'm Han Xing, and this is Lu Hanchuan."

    Ye Xiaoxiao's eyes widened.

    Han Xing... Lu Hanchuan!

    No way!

    I thought they were nobodies, but they’re actually big deals.

    These two were the heavy hitters in the compound, though they weren't mentioned much in the story, they were nothing like the background characters of the Ye family.

    Until the end of the novel, the male and female leads were still trying to suck up to Han Xing, a real estate tycoon in the capital, for some business collaborations.

    Lu Hanchuan, on the other hand, was even more of a mystery.

    All that was known was that he was a force to be reckoned with in the compound, and even the most arrogant second-generation heirs had to bow to him.

    In the book, he was even nicknamed the King of Hell—a title that spoke volumes.

    Lu Hanchuan smirked, amused by the young girl's reaction, "Oh? Are we really that well-known?"

    Ye Xiaoxiao nodded enthusiastically, "Very famous."

    Han Xing chuckled self-deprecatingly, "Hahaha, I’m sure it’s not a good one."

    Lu Hanchuan: "Where are you living now? What are your plans next?"

    He didn't believe that someone who had fallen from grace wouldn't feel a sense of loss, but so far, Ye Xiaoxiao had been way too composed.

    "I’m staying with the Ye family in Baichuan Village. For now, I’m just focusing on studying and preparing for next year’s college entrance exam."

    Ye Xiaoxiao felt a bit puzzled. Didn’t they say they weren’t close?

    Why did Lu Hanchuan seem so concerned about her?

    Could he have had some other connection with the original owner?

    This thought made her a bit nervous.

    Lu Hanchuan didn’t press further.

    Instead, he pulled out a pen and paper, wrote something down, and handed it to her.

    Ye Xiaoxiao took it and was surprised to see an address and a phone number.

    The address was quite far, and finding a place to make a call in this era wasn’t easy.

    In the town, only the post office and the supply and marketing cooperative had public phones available.

    Lu Hanchuan said, “If you need help, give me a call.”

    Ye Xiaoxiao replied, “Thank you.”

    Lu Hanchuan and Han Xing had other business to take care of and didn’t plan to stay in Songlin Town.

    After giving her the phone number, Lu Hanchuan and Han Xing got into the car and left.

    In the car, Han Xing finally asked the question that had been on his mind.

    “Brother Lu, something seems off with you.”

    Lu Hanchuan ignored him, reverting to his usual aloofness, “Mind your own business, or head back to Beijing.”

    Han Xing: “...”
